Fix stacked runlevel support
Patch was provided by Max Hacking <max.gentoo.bugzilla@hacking.co.uk> and slightly fixed by Alexander Vershilov <qnikst@gentoo.org> and William Hubbs <williamh@gentoo.org>. Fixes: 1). Rebase to newest OpenRC version. 2). Remove code style fixes. Port to currect code style. 3). Fix rc_runlevel_stack instead of introducing new function. 4). Make get_runlevel_chain a private function. X-Gentoo-Bug: 467368 X-Gentoo-Bug-URL: https://bugs.gentoo.org/show_bug.cgi?id=467368

+/* Returns a list of all the chained runlevels used by the
+ * specified runlevel in dependency order, including the
+ * specified runlevel. */
+static void
+get_runlevel_chain(const char *runlevel, RC_STRINGLIST *level_list)
+{
+ char path[PATH_MAX];
+ RC_STRINGLIST *dirs;
+ RC_STRING *d, *dn;
+
+ /*
+ * If we haven't been passed a runlevel or a level list, or
+ * if the passed runlevel doesn't exist then we're done already!
+ */
+ if (!runlevel || !level_list || !rc_runlevel_exists(runlevel))
+ return;
+
+ /*
+ * We want to add this runlevel to the list but if
+ * it is already in the list it needs to go at the
+ * end again.
+ */
+ if (rc_stringlist_find(level_list, runlevel))
+ rc_stringlist_delete(level_list, runlevel);
+ rc_stringlist_add(level_list, runlevel);
+
+ /*
+ * We can now do exactly the above procedure for our chained
+ * runlevels.
+ */
+ snprintf(path, sizeof(path), "%s/%s", RC_RUNLEVELDIR, runlevel);
+ dirs = ls_dir(path, LS_DIR);
+ TAILQ_FOREACH_SAFE(d, dirs, entries, dn)
+ get_runlevel_chain(d->value, level_list);
+}
